Choosing the Best First Steps: A Guide to Infant Walking Shoes

Getting your little one ready for their first wobbly steps is an exciting time! But before they take off running (or more likely, tripping!), you need the right shoes. Infant walking shoes aren’t just cute; they support your baby’s developing feet. This guide will help you pick the perfect pair.

Key Features to Look For

When shopping for infant walking shoes, keep these important features in mind:

  • Flexibility: The shoe should bend easily at the ball of the foot. This lets your baby’s foot move naturally as they walk and explore. Stiff shoes can make it harder for them to learn to walk.
  • Lightweight: Heavy shoes can weigh your baby down. Look for shoes that feel light. This makes it easier for them to lift their feet and move around.
  • Good Grip: The sole needs to have some texture. This gives your baby traction on different surfaces. It helps prevent slips and falls.
  • Breathable Material: Babies’ feet sweat! You want shoes made from materials that let air flow. This keeps their feet cool and dry. It also helps prevent irritation.
  • Secure Fastening: Shoes should stay on your baby’s feet. Look for adjustable straps, like Velcro. This allows you to get a snug but comfortable fit.
  • Room to Grow: Babies’ feet grow fast! Ensure there’s a little extra space at the toe. This gives their toes room to wiggle and grow without being squished.

Important Materials

The materials used in infant shoes play a big role in comfort and durability.

  • Leather: Genuine leather is a great choice. It’s soft, flexible, and breathable. It also molds to your baby’s foot over time.
  • Canvas: Canvas is lightweight and breathable. It’s a good option for warmer weather. It’s also usually more affordable.
  • Mesh: Mesh is very breathable. It’s often used in athletic-style shoes. It helps keep feet cool.
  • Rubber Soles: Rubber soles provide good grip. They are also flexible. This is crucial for a shoe that supports walking.

Frequently Asked Questions about Infant Walking Shoes

Q: When should my baby start wearing walking shoes?

A: Your baby can start wearing walking shoes when they begin to pull themselves up and cruise. You can also put them on when they are taking their first independent steps. It’s important that they are already showing signs of wanting to walk.

Q: How do I know if the shoes fit correctly?

A: You should be able to fit your pinky finger between the back of your baby’s heel and the shoe. There should also be about a thumb’s width of space between their longest toe and the end of the shoe. Make sure the shoe isn’t too tight around the width of their foot.

Q: Should infant shoes have arch support?

A: Most infant walking shoes do not need significant arch support. Babies’ feet are still developing. Their arches are not fully formed yet. Flexibility and a good fit are more important at this stage.

Q: Can I use hand-me-down shoes for my baby?

A: It’s generally not recommended to use hand-me-down shoes. Shoes mold to the wearer’s foot over time. A used shoe might already be shaped to another child’s foot. This could affect your baby’s natural foot development and gait.

Q: How often should I check my baby’s shoe size?

A: Babies’ feet grow very quickly. You should check their shoe size every 1-2 months. Look for signs like red marks on their feet or the shoes looking too tight.

Q: Are soft-soled shoes better than hard-soled shoes for infants?

A: For babies just learning to walk, soft-soled shoes are often preferred. They offer more flexibility and allow for better feel of the ground. As they become more confident walkers, slightly more structured, but still flexible, shoes with a bit more grip are good.

Q: What is the difference between pre-walking shoes and walking shoes?

A: Pre-walking shoes, often called “crib shoes,” are very soft and flexible. They are meant more for warmth and protection indoors. Walking shoes have slightly more structure and a grippier sole to support a baby who is actively walking and exploring.

Q: Should infant shoes be waterproof?

A: Waterproofing is usually not a primary concern for infant walking shoes. The focus is on breathability and flexibility. If you need shoes for wet weather, look for specific water-resistant options, but ensure they still meet the key features for infant shoes.

Q: How important is the shoe’s weight?

A: The weight of the shoe is very important. Lighter shoes make it easier for babies to lift their feet and practice walking. Heavy shoes can be tiring and hinder their learning process.

Q: Can my baby wear socks with walking shoes?

A: Yes, your baby can wear socks with walking shoes. Choose thin socks that don’t bunch up inside the shoe. Ensure the socks don’t make the shoes too tight. The socks should also be breathable.
